Transaction 1717cc74aefbd13e20bc63f213632d56bf18ca2a4631a49aa48398664c3245f1
1 Input
1 Output
-
1717cc74aefbd13e20bc63f213632d56bf18ca2a4631a49aa48398664c3245f1:0
- value
- 5258099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 876642307152d21e8ac86267738196e9744c7f2f OP_EQUAL
- address
- 3E2weVMEhaVry4fWFJkRdYV1Bnz4kB1ZMr